A negative ion photoelectron spectroscopic study on the solvation energies of an excess electron in the size-selected aromatic hydrocarbon nanoclusters was presented. The second solvation layer was essential for stable binding of the excess electron in these clusters. The applicability of the generalized cluster size equation was examined in the nondipolar aromatic hydrocarbon systems.
